Copthorne Bank is in Copthorne, Crawley and in Mid Sussex district. RH10 3JH is located in the Copthorne & Worth elect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of Horsham.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Copthorne Bank was 18.1 per 1,000 residents, which is 53.4% lower than the Ardingly, Balcombe & Turners Hill average. The most reported crime type was Shoplifting.
Copthorne Bank has the 15th lowest crime rate of 82 local areas in Ardingly, Balcombe & Turners Hill and the 93rd lowest crime rate of 454 local areas in Mid Sussex .
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 6.0 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been falling year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-68.9%.
